> Trying to build the iconv module from the s390 sysdep directory turned
> out to be rather tricky (at least for me not being familiar with the
> libc build machinery). After experimenting with several makefile
> variables I've ended up trying to mimic as much as necessary from the
> iconvdata Makefile until the module got built.

You should add the rules to the sysdeps/s390/s390x/Makefile.  Don't
define all these variables which might clash.  Don't  indent variable
definitinos.


> The current Makefile installs the new module into lib/gconv/s390x and
> generates a gconv-modules file which is installed into the very same
> dir.  The modules therefore will not be used until the path of the
> directory is appended to GCONV_PATH.

You should add the module in the regular gconv directory.  To add the
rules to gconv-modules add a rule to your Makefile which depends on the
gconv-modules file being copied into the compile directory, then you
check whether the new entry has been added and if not, add it.
